WebOct 2, 2024 · Let’s begin when last year’s antlers fall off sometime in the mid-winter following the conclusion of the breeding cycle. The antlers separate from the skull at the point of attachment called the pedicel – the base. The antlers – a growth of bone that is chemically altered to fatigue when the animal’s hormones change following the rut ... WebMar 19, 2024 · Antlers fall off when they’re good and ready to fall off. If you break an antler off before its time, you risk injuring not only the buck’s pedicle, but the skull around and beneath it. (They can) develop pedicle infections that become fatal cranial abscesses. We shouldn’t subject deer to such long-term agony.” can obesity can lead to type 2 diabetes

WebApr 27, 2024 · What that means is antlers hit the ground from November to April, and there’s a ton of variability both between regions and individuals. Moose are the first to drop the weight. They cast their antlers, which can weigh 40 pounds apiece, between late November and late December.
